Ingredients

Scale
  • 12 oz rigatoni pasta
  • 1 lb ground turkey or chicken sausage (spicy or mild)
  • 2 (14.5 oz) cans diced tomatoes (packed in juice)
  • 2 medium zucchinis, diced
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• ½ c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
  • ¼ cup fresh basil, chopped

Instructions

  1. Cook the rigatoni in boiling salted water until al dente; drain and set aside.
  2. In a large skillet over medium heat, add olive oil and crumble in the sausage. Cook for about 5-7 minutes until browned.
  3. Stir in minced garlic and diced zucchini; sauté for 3-4 minutes until zucchini softens.
  4. Add canned diced tomatoes with their juices; let simmer for about 10 minutes until slightly thickened.
  5. Toss the cooked rigatoni and chopped basil into the skillet; mix well to combine.
  6. Serve hot, topped with freshly grated Parmesan cheese and additional basil if desired.
